p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/devel/meson



Module Name:    pkgsrc
Committed By:   adam
Date:           Fri May 27 12:26:51 UTC 2022

Modified Files:
        pkgsrc/devel/meson: Makefile PLIST distinfo

Log Message:
meson: updated to 0.62.1

0.62.1

Bash completion scripts sourced in meson devenv
Setup GDB auto-load for meson devenv
Print modified environment variables with meson devenv --dump
New method and separator kwargs on environment() and meson.add_devenv()
New custom dependency for libdl
pkgconfig.generate will now include variables for builtin directories when referenced
New keyword argument verbose for tests and benchmarks
CMake support for versions <3.17.0 is deprecated
Removal of the RPM module
CMake server API support is removed
Rust proc-macro crates
found programs now have a version method
Minimum required Python version updated to 3.7
Added support for XML translations using itstool
JNI System Dependency Modules
New unstable wayland module
Experimental command to convert environments to cross files
Added optional '--allow-dirty' flag for the 'dist' command
ldconfig is no longer run on install
Added support for Texas Instruments MSP430 and ARM compilers
cmake.configure_package_config_file can now take a dict
Deprecated java.generate_native_header() in favor of the new java.generate_native_headers()
New option to choose python installation environment
JDK System Dependency Renamed from jdk to jni
i18n.merge_file no longer arbitrarily leaves your project half-built
All directory options now support paths outside of prefix
meson install --strip
Support for ARM Ltd. Clang toolchain
structured_sources()
New custom dependency for OpenSSL
D features in declare_dependency
arch_independent kwarg in cmake.write_basic_package_version_file
dataonly Pkgconfig Default Install Path
JAR default install dir


To generate a diff of this commit:
cvs rdiff -u -r1.38 -r1.39 pkgsrc/devel/meson/Makefile
cvs rdiff -u -r1.13 -r1.14 pkgsrc/devel/meson/PLIST
cvs rdiff -u -r1.35 -r1.36 pkgsrc/devel/meson/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/devel/meson/Makefile
diff -u pkgsrc/devel/meson/Makefile:1.38 pkgsrc/devel/meson/Makefile:1.39
--- pkgsrc/devel/meson/Makefile:1.38    Tue Mar 15 05:43:36 2022
+++ pkgsrc/devel/meson/Makefile Fri May 27 12:26:50 2022
@@ -1,6 +1,6 @@
-# $NetBSD: Makefile,v 1.38 2022/03/15 05:43:36 adam Exp $
+# $NetBSD: Makefile,v 1.39 2022/05/27 12:26:50 adam Exp $
 
-DISTNAME=      meson-0.61.3
+DISTNAME=      meson-0.62.1
 CATEGORIES=    devel python
 MASTER_SITES=  ${MASTER_SITE_PYPI:=m/meson/}
 
@@ -41,7 +41,7 @@ REPLACE_PYTHON+=      test\ cases/windows/8\ 
 REPLACE_PYTHON+=       tools/*.py
 
 do-test:
-       cd ${WRKSRC} && ${PYTHONBIN} run_tests.py
+       cd ${WRKSRC} && ${SETENV} ${TEST_ENV} ${PYTHONBIN} run_tests.py
 
 .include "../../lang/python/application.mk"
 .include "../../lang/python/egg.mk"

Index: pkgsrc/devel/meson/PLIST
diff -u pkgsrc/devel/meson/PLIST:1.13 pkgsrc/devel/meson/PLIST:1.14
--- pkgsrc/devel/meson/PLIST:1.13       Tue Feb 15 10:00:05 2022
+++ pkgsrc/devel/meson/PLIST    Fri May 27 12:26:50 2022
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.13 2022/02/15 10:00:05 adam Exp $
+@comment $NetBSD: PLIST,v 1.14 2022/05/27 12:26:50 adam Exp $
 bin/meson
 ${PYSITELIB}/${EGG_INFODIR}/PKG-INFO
 ${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t
@@ -75,12 +75,13 @@ ${PYSITELIB}/mesonbuild/build.pyo
 ${PYSITELIB}/mesonbuild/cmake/__init__.py
 ${PYSITELIB}/mesonbuild/cmake/__init__.pyc
 ${PYSITELIB}/mesonbuild/cmake/__init__.pyo
-${PYSITELIB}/mesonbuild/cmake/client.py
-${PYSITELIB}/mesonbuild/cmake/client.pyc
-${PYSITELIB}/mesonbuild/cmake/client.pyo
 ${PYSITELIB}/mesonbuild/cmake/common.py
 ${PYSITELIB}/mesonbuild/cmake/common.pyc
 ${PYSITELIB}/mesonbuild/cmake/common.pyo
+${PYSITELIB}/mesonbuild/cmake/data/__init__.py
+${PYSITELIB}/mesonbuild/cmake/data/__init__.pyc
+${PYSITELIB}/mesonbuild/cmake/data/__init__.pyo
+${PYSITELIB}/mesonbuild/cmake/data/preload.cmake
 ${PYSITELIB}/mesonbuild/cmake/executor.py
 ${PYSITELIB}/mesonbuild/cmake/executor.pyc
 ${PYSITELIB}/mesonbuild/cmake/executor.pyo
@@ -144,9 +145,6 @@ ${PYSITELIB}/mesonbuild/compilers/mixins
 ${PYSITELIB}/mesonbuild/compilers/mixins/arm.py
 ${PYSITELIB}/mesonbuild/compilers/mixins/arm.pyc
 ${PYSITELIB}/mesonbuild/compilers/mixins/arm.pyo
-${PYSITELIB}/mesonbuild/compilers/mixins/c2000.py
-${PYSITELIB}/mesonbuild/compilers/mixins/c2000.pyc
-${PYSITELIB}/mesonbuild/compilers/mixins/c2000.pyo
 ${PYSITELIB}/mesonbuild/compilers/mixins/ccrx.py
 ${PYSITELIB}/mesonbuild/compilers/mixins/ccrx.pyc
 ${PYSITELIB}/mesonbuild/compilers/mixins/ccrx.pyo
@@ -177,6 +175,9 @@ ${PYSITELIB}/mesonbuild/compilers/mixins
 ${PYSITELIB}/mesonbuild/compilers/mixins/pgi.py
 ${PYSITELIB}/mesonbuild/compilers/mixins/pgi.pyc
 ${PYSITELIB}/mesonbuild/compilers/mixins/pgi.pyo
+${PYSITELIB}/mesonbuild/compilers/mixins/ti.py
+${PYSITELIB}/mesonbuild/compilers/mixins/ti.pyc
+${PYSITELIB}/mesonbuild/compilers/mixins/ti.pyo
 ${PYSITELIB}/mesonbuild/compilers/mixins/visualstudio.py
 ${PYSITELIB}/mesonbuild/compilers/mixins/visualstudio.pyc
 ${PYSITELIB}/mesonbuild/compilers/mixins/visualstudio.pyo
@@ -222,6 +223,12 @@ ${PYSITELIB}/mesonbuild/dependencies/con
 ${PYSITELIB}/mesonbuild/dependencies/cuda.py
 ${PYSITELIB}/mesonbuild/dependencies/cuda.pyc
 ${PYSITELIB}/mesonbuild/dependencies/cuda.pyo
+${PYSITELIB}/mesonbuild/dependencies/data/CMakeLists.txt
+${PYSITELIB}/mesonbuild/dependencies/data/CMakeListsLLVM.txt
+${PYSITELIB}/mesonbuild/dependencies/data/CMakePathInfo.txt
+${PYSITELIB}/mesonbuild/dependencies/data/__init__.py
+${PYSITELIB}/mesonbuild/dependencies/data/__init__.pyc
+${PYSITELIB}/mesonbuild/dependencies/data/__init__.pyo
 ${PYSITELIB}/mesonbuild/dependencies/detect.py
 ${PYSITELIB}/mesonbuild/dependencies/detect.pyc
 ${PYSITELIB}/mesonbuild/dependencies/detect.pyo
@@ -450,9 +457,6 @@ ${PYSITELIB}/mesonbuild/modules/qt5.pyo
 ${PYSITELIB}/mesonbuild/modules/qt6.py
 ${PYSITELIB}/mesonbuild/modules/qt6.pyc
 ${PYSITELIB}/mesonbuild/modules/qt6.pyo
-${PYSITELIB}/mesonbuild/modules/rpm.py
-${PYSITELIB}/mesonbuild/modules/rpm.pyc
-${PYSITELIB}/mesonbuild/modules/rpm.pyo
 ${PYSITELIB}/mesonbuild/modules/sourceset.py
 ${PYSITELIB}/mesonbuild/modules/sourceset.pyc
 ${PYSITELIB}/mesonbuild/modules/sourceset.pyo
@@ -471,6 +475,9 @@ ${PYSITELIB}/mesonbuild/modules/unstable
 ${PYSITELIB}/mesonbuild/modules/unstable_simd.py
 ${PYSITELIB}/mesonbuild/modules/unstable_simd.pyc
 ${PYSITELIB}/mesonbuild/modules/unstable_simd.pyo
+${PYSITELIB}/mesonbuild/modules/unstable_wayland.py
+${PYSITELIB}/mesonbuild/modules/unstable_wayland.pyc
+${PYSITELIB}/mesonbuild/modules/unstable_wayland.pyo
 ${PYSITELIB}/mesonbuild/modules/windows.py
 ${PYSITELIB}/mesonbuild/modules/windows.pyc
 ${PYSITELIB}/mesonbuild/modules/windows.pyo
@@ -514,6 +521,9 @@ ${PYSITELIB}/mesonbuild/scripts/cmake_ru
 ${PYSITELIB}/mesonbuild/scripts/cmake_run_ctgt.pyc
 ${PYSITELIB}/mesonbuild/scripts/cmake_run_ctgt.pyo
 ${PYSITELIB}/mesonbuild/scripts/cmd_or_ps.ps1
+${PYSITELIB}/mesonbuild/scripts/copy.py
+${PYSITELIB}/mesonbuild/scripts/copy.pyc
+${PYSITELIB}/mesonbuild/scripts/copy.pyo
 ${PYSITELIB}/mesonbuild/scripts/coverage.py
 ${PYSITELIB}/mesonbuild/scripts/coverage.pyc
 ${PYSITELIB}/mesonbuild/scripts/coverage.pyo
@@ -529,6 +539,9 @@ ${PYSITELIB}/mesonbuild/scripts/depscan.
 ${PYSITELIB}/mesonbuild/scripts/dirchanger.py
 ${PYSITELIB}/mesonbuild/scripts/dirchanger.pyc
 ${PYSITELIB}/mesonbuild/scripts/dirchanger.pyo
+${PYSITELIB}/mesonbuild/scripts/env2mfile.py
+${PYSITELIB}/mesonbuild/scripts/env2mfile.pyc
+${PYSITELIB}/mesonbuild/scripts/env2mfile.pyo
 ${PYSITELIB}/mesonbuild/scripts/externalproject.py
 ${PYSITELIB}/mesonbuild/scripts/externalproject.pyc
 ${PYSITELIB}/mesonbuild/scripts/externalproject.pyo
@@ -541,6 +554,9 @@ ${PYSITELIB}/mesonbuild/scripts/gtkdoche
 ${PYSITELIB}/mesonbuild/scripts/hotdochelper.py
 ${PYSITELIB}/mesonbuild/scripts/hotdochelper.pyc
 ${PYSITELIB}/mesonbuild/scripts/hotdochelper.pyo
+${PYSITELIB}/mesonbuild/scripts/itstool.py
+${PYSITELIB}/mesonbuild/scripts/itstool.pyc
+${PYSITELIB}/mesonbuild/scripts/itstool.pyo
 ${PYSITELIB}/mesonbuild/scripts/meson_exe.py
 ${PYSITELIB}/mesonbuild/scripts/meson_exe.pyc
 ${PYSITELIB}/mesonbuild/scripts/meson_exe.pyo

Index: pkgsrc/devel/meson/distinfo
diff -u pkgsrc/devel/meson/distinfo:1.35 pkgsrc/devel/meson/distinfo:1.36
--- pkgsrc/devel/meson/distinfo:1.35    Tue Mar 15 05:43:36 2022
+++ pkgsrc/devel/meson/distinfo Fri May 27 12:26:50 2022
@@ -1,8 +1,8 @@
-$NetBSD: distinfo,v 1.35 2022/03/15 05:43:36 adam Exp $
+$NetBSD: distinfo,v 1.36 2022/05/27 12:26:50 adam Exp $
 
-BLAKE2s (meson-0.61.3.tar.gz) = 949834e1a5c85066e04a9b999e1af3b350e62f12be0f11e8b60856fd3a08be0b
-SHA512 (meson-0.61.3.tar.gz) = 955c56cbaeb23a33a5e536eee547312ca5f1122aaa03d839113a2b2bcd9a0486ab24d1783220d9981c29ed9b4bda06a971cb0e21aa9f32d57f6696fa27853da8
-Size (meson-0.61.3.tar.gz) = 2011631 bytes
+BLAKE2s (meson-0.62.1.tar.gz) = 0acdc68fb82e9d07105381000bf182622115a556964338127aea48ef9763acaf
+SHA512 (meson-0.62.1.tar.gz) = 52d2d06c27275b824046164403908be8555faed33aef862940623cef3e4f84b4c9b8d461c291642e6ea2c0db30b2ec4a99f46bde5d54945a26c1dbeca219cc32
+Size (meson-0.62.1.tar.gz) = 2034805 bytes
 SHA1 (patch-mesonbuild_compilers_detect.py) = 6379aaae55a7175291133335f15307b53aee4384
 SHA1 (patch-mesonbuild_compilers_mixins_gnu.py) = cc9fe3204c7cf003d288ef5635fa7853a44a2e34
 SHA1 (patch-mesonbuild_dependencies_dev.py) = 44a3bdb96a1afad1f1a9110b6187c9daad0d449f



Home | Main Index | Thread Index | Old Index